VLO 73 is a parchment codex from the first half of the 12th c., its 63 leaves measuring 186 x 120 mm. Written space covers 160 x 100 mm (26-31 lines in hard point ruling). The text is written by several scribes in Minuscula sub-carolina. Initials and inscriptions are in dark ink. The codex has a 17th-c. cardboard binding with parchment protection, made for Paul or Alexandre Pétau.
